Output 664a8a6b32a793d0968ee4c79eda145bea1f7a37114b7fee303aed38a40f9c74:0

value
445943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ce32090677a2835fc628094308969ea38eb309b0 OP_EQUAL
address
3LVH4a63JysJo8KZWLNfcGrevcLouEM5a1
transaction
664a8a6b32a793d0968ee4c79eda145bea1f7a37114b7fee303aed38a40f9c74
spent
true